Output 9306689b36b3e3462a405a2a1bc0ff76bb8faa9d9b23489acc3ab6d09ce80588:1

value
47525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e3e66e74710fa5cb99d1a55a77bebb0a639759 OP_EQUAL
address
323axu14dBjqRGsSEYCeADPp5c5jHPmza5
transaction
9306689b36b3e3462a405a2a1bc0ff76bb8faa9d9b23489acc3ab6d09ce80588
spent
true